    Cyprium Metals (ASX:CYM) strikes high-grade copper at Heeler prospect

    Article Image

    Cyprium Metals reported a high-grade copper discovery at the Heeler prospect, located approximately 10km southwest of their Hollandaire copper-gold deposit near Cue.

    Drilling results from hole 24CURC004 include an intercept of 15m at 3.26% copper, 0.70g/t gold, 7.4g/t silver, and 151ppm cobalt from 70m downhole, with a higher-grade zone of 7m at 5.04% copper.

    Another intercept in the same hole revealed 3m at 1.09% copper and 0.44g/t gold from 108m.

    Cyprium Metals, in a joint venture with Ramelius Resources (ASX: RMS), holds an 80% interest in base metals.
